I went to the Dr after trying for only five months but that was b/c I wasn't ovulating (but I also needed my yearly PAP, so I combined my IF questions with that appt)
If you are Oing every cycle then I think you should wait until you hit the year mark. If you suspect a problem (like me, I was anov for three months in a row) then go.
Def temp. If I didn't temp then I wouldn't have known I wasn't Oing. Temping teaches you about your body/cycles.
